semiconductorMg3Dy1 is an intermetallic compound within the magnesium-dysprosium binary system, representing a research-phase material that combines a lightweight base metal (magnesium) with a rare-earth element (dysprosium). This compound is primarily of interest in advanced materials research rather than established industrial production, with investigations focused on understanding how rare-earth additions modify magnesium's mechanical and thermal properties for potential high-performance applications. The dysprosium addition is explored for enhancing creep resistance, thermal stability, and strengthening mechanisms in magnesium-based systems, making this material relevant to researchers developing next-generation lightweight structural alloys.
